FINAL STATE INTERACTION IN PROTON-ANTIPROTON ANNIHILATION AT REST

Abstract

The effects of the symmetrization of the wave function of final particles in proton-antiproton annihilation at rest leading to (Pi-Pi) and (K-Pi) resonant states are studied. The angular correlation between the decay products of the resonant states are quite different from those one would expect from the decay of an isolated particle. (Author)
